影响索-混凝土组合梁节点受力性能的主要因素

摘    要:索-混凝土结构能够充分发挥组合材料在技术和经济上的优越性,体现了现阶段工程材料的发展方向,是一种极具发展潜力和应用价值的组合结构。节点是结构中的关键部位,也是施工难点,合理地设计节点对结构的安全和整个工程的造价具有重要的理论意义与工程实际价值。采用ANSYS软件研究了混凝土强度、节点梁端箍筋配筋率、梁柱纵筋配筋率等因素对节点受力性能的影响规律,获得完整、准确的节点受力性能信息,对于正确进行框架分析,保证结构体系的安全可靠具有重要的意义。

Main Influence Factors of Mechanical Properties on the Nodal of Cable-Concrete Beam

Abstract:Concrete filled steel tubular structure gives full play to its two materials' superiorityin technology and economics over others, embodies the development direction of the engineering material at present, it is a composite structure with great development potential and application value. The joint is the key part of the structure, it also has technology difficulties in construction. The reasonable design of the joint related to the safety of the structure and the cost of the whole project, it is of great significance in the theoretical research and the engineering application. There-fore, obtaining complete and accurate information about the joints' performance is of great important for the frame analysis and the safety and reliability of the structure.
